Choosing the Right Quotes: Capturing the Essence of Your Story
This is the heart of your project. The quotes you select will determine the difficulty and the overall narrative flow of your crossword. Aim for quotes that are:
- Memorable: Choose snippets that vividly recall significant events or emotions. They don't need to be lengthy; a few key words can carry a powerful impact.
- Varied in Length: A mix of short and longer quotes will create a more challenging and interesting puzzle.
- Thematically Connected: While variety is good, ensure the quotes relate to the overarching theme of your memoir. This provides coherence and prevents the puzzle from feeling disjointed.
- Easily Clued: Consider how you will create clues for your quotes. Will you use synonyms, related words, or descriptive phrases? Make sure you can craft clues that are challenging but solvable.
Designing the Grid: Structure and Flow
The grid is the canvas for your story. Several factors need consideration:
- Grid Size: Start with a smaller grid to test your quote selection and cluing strategy. You can always expand later.
- Word Placement: Strategically place quotes to create an aesthetically pleasing and logically flowing puzzle. Avoid overly clustered areas or long, isolated words.
- Clue Placement: Designate a clear area for your clues. Number the quotes consistently.
Crafting Engaging Clues: The Key to Solvability
Your clues are crucial. They should be challenging yet solvable, offering enough information to guide the solver without giving away the answer too easily. Consider these techniques:
- Synonyms and Related Words: Use words that hint at the meaning of the quote without directly stating it.
- Descriptive Phrases: Paint a picture of the event or emotion associated with the quote.
- Contextual Clues: Use clues that relate to the context of the quote within your life story.
Testing and Refining: A Crucial Step
Before sharing your masterpiece, test it! Ask a friend or family member to try solving it. Their feedback will help you identify any ambiguities, overly difficult clues, or areas that need improvement. This iterative process is key to creating a polished and enjoyable experience.
